光波在左右手系材料界面处的传输特性
Transmission Characters of Optical Waves at the Interface Between LHM and RHM
【摘要】 根据电磁场理论推导了左、右手系材料界面处菲涅耳公式及菲涅耳系数的角度表达形式 ,研究了界面处反射系数和透射系数的变化情况 ,以及布鲁斯特角的确定和全反射时的光学特性 ,作为进一步研究左手系的特性和相关光学薄膜器件设计的理论基础
【Abstract】 Fresnel formulae at the interface between LHM (left-handed material) and RHM (right-handed material) are derived from EM theory. The reflection and transmission coefficients, the existence of Brewster angle and the characters of total reflection have been researched thoroughly. And these should be the foundation of further research and the design of thin film devices with LHMs.
